Hemisphere — the best accommodation for Mars

To this conclusion came the jury of the international competition of City Design Mars 2017, the results of which first place was awarded to a team of developers and designers from MIT, who presented his vision of the Martian cities of the future. Redwood Forest (“Forest of redwoods”) is the design concept of the alien city — represents the interconnected tunnels of the hemisphere within which future Martian colonists will be able to live and work.

Hemisphere from inside will resemble the crowns of the trees, as they are encouraged to create branched structures, covered with an inflatable membrane shell. The design of each dome may vary, so they can be adapted not only for work but also for a comfortable existence. Inside, you will have public spaces, gardens or even ponds.

The water also did not forget to pay attention to: solar energy collected by the domes, the water will go inside the porous coating of the domes, providing residents with protection against radiation and overheating. The heated water can be used for irrigation of plants and needs of the residents.
